Behold, I will send the boy, saying, 'Go, find the arrows!' If I tell the boy, 'Behold, the arrows are on this side of you. Take them;' then come; for there is peace to you and no hurt, as Yahweh lives.

1 Samuel 20:21

Version Text
Hebrew והנה אשלח את־הנער לך מצא את־החצים אם־אמר אמר לנער הנה החצים ממך והנה קחנו ובאה כי־שלום לך ואין דבר חי־יהוה׃
Greek και ιδου αποστελω το παιδαριον λεγων δευρο ευρε μοι την σχιζαν εαν ειπω λεγων τω παιδαριω ωδε η σχιζα απο σου και ωδε λαβε αυτην παραγινου οτι ειρηνη σοι και ουκ εστιν λογος ζη
Latin Mittam quoque et puerum, dicens ei : Vade, et affer mihi sagittas.
KJV And, behold, I will send a lad, saying, Go, find out the arrows. If I expressly say unto the lad, Behold, the arrows are on this side of thee, take them; then come thou: for there is peace to thee, and no hurt; as the LORD liveth.
WEB Behold, I will send the boy, saying, 'Go, find the arrows!' If I tell the boy, 'Behold, the arrows are on this side of you. Take them;' then come; for there is peace to you and no hurt, as Yahweh lives.
